What it does

Orders at the table

Your waiter takes the order standing at the table, on the phone already in their pocket. Nothing to write down twice.

Tickets to the kitchen

Fire the order and the kitchen gets a numbered ticket. Prices never appear on it, so the kitchen sees food and nothing else.

Your floor, your layout

Group tables into areas: ground floor, terrace, garden. The grid on the phone matches the room your staff are standing in.

Bills that add up

Discounts, service charge and tax are worked out the same way every time, in whole paisa, and the numbers on a bill are frozen once it is handed over.

Menus you edit yourself

Categories, items and prices are yours to change. No support ticket to raise the price of a plate of momo.

One place to look

Sign in from any browser to see what is open on the floor, what has been billed, and what the day came to.
